Explore a linear programming approach for optimizing the relocation of points of interest in adaptive maps during a 22-minute conference talk at GSI. Gain insights into innovative techniques for improving map readability and user experience by strategically repositioning important landmarks and features. Learn how this mathematical model can enhance cartographic visualization while maintaining spatial relationships and minimizing visual clutter in dynamic mapping applications.
